Remove OS upgrade script 79/211979/2
authorKichan Kwon <k_c.kwon@samsung.com>
Tue, 13 Aug 2019 05:14:13 +0000 (14:14 +0900)
committerKichan Kwon <k_c.kwon@samsung.com>
Tue, 12 May 2020 03:22:01 +0000 (12:22 +0900)
Change-Id: I3bee154956c3eba7829d97c744807e3d77ea8184
Signed-off-by: Kichan Kwon <k_c.kwon@samsung.com>
packaging/context-service.spec
scripts/500.context-service.sh [deleted file]

index 24de18a..32e25d3 100644 (file)
@@ -10,8 +10,6 @@ Source2:      org.tizen.context.conf
 Source3:       contextd-agent.service
 Source4:       contextd-agent.socket
 
-%define upgrade_script_path /usr/share/upgrade/scripts
-
 BuildRequires: cmake
 BuildRequires: pkgconfig(libsystemd-daemon)
 BuildRequires: pkgconfig(libsystemd-login)
@@ -70,16 +68,12 @@ install -m 0644 %{SOURCE3} %{buildroot}%{_unitdir_user}
 install -m 0644 %{SOURCE4} %{buildroot}%{_unitdir_user}
 ln -s ../contextd-agent.socket %{buildroot}%{_unitdir_user}/sockets.target.wants/contextd-agent.socket
 
-mkdir -p %{buildroot}%{upgrade_script_path}
-cp -f scripts/500.context-service.sh %{buildroot}%{upgrade_script_path}
-
 %files
 %manifest packaging/%{name}.manifest
 %config %{_sysconfdir}/dbus-1/system.d/*
 %{_bindir}/contextd
 %{_unitdir}/contextd.service
 %{_unitdir}/*/contextd.service
-%{upgrade_script_path}/500.context-service.sh
 %license LICENSE
 
 %files -n context-agent
diff --git a/scripts/500.context-service.sh b/scripts/500.context-service.sh
deleted file mode 100644 (file)
index 3c37a7d..0000000
+++ /dev/null
@@ -1,48 +0,0 @@
-#!/bin/sh
-PATH=/bin:/usr/bin:/sbin:/usr/sbin
-source /usr/share/upgrade/rw-update-macro.inc
-
-# Macro
-DB_DIR_30=/opt/usr/home/owner/.applications/dbspace
-DB_CONTEXT_30=$DB_DIR_30/.context-service.db
-
-DB_DIR_40=/opt/dbspace
-DB_CONTEXT_40_SENSOR_RECORDER=$DB_DIR_40/.context-sensor-recorder.db
-
-# Get version info
-get_version_info
-
-#------------------------------------------------#
-# context-service patch for upgrade (3.0 -> 4.0) #
-#------------------------------------------------#
-if [ "$OLD_VER" = "3.0.0.0" ]; then
-
-# Move DB (context-service -> context-sensor-recorder)
-mv $DB_CONTEXT_30 $DB_CONTEXT_40_SENSOR_RECORDER
-mv $DB_CONTEXT_30-shm $DB_CONTEXT_40_SENSOR_RECORDER-shm
-mv $DB_CONTEXT_30-wal $DB_CONTEXT_40_SENSOR_RECORDER-wal
-
-chown service_fw:service_fw $DB_CONTEXT_40_SENSOR_RECORDER
-chown service_fw:service_fw $DB_CONTEXT_40_SENSOR_RECORDER-shm
-chown service_fw:service_fw $DB_CONTEXT_40_SENSOR_RECORDER-wal
-
-chsmack -a System $DB_CONTEXT_40_SENSOR_RECORDER
-chsmack -a System $DB_CONTEXT_40_SENSOR_RECORDER-shm
-chsmack -a System $DB_CONTEXT_40_SENSOR_RECORDER-wal
-
-# Drop tables not related to sensor recorder
-sqlite3 $DB_CONTEXT_40_SENSOR_RECORDER << EOF
-
-DROP TABLE IF EXISTS ContextTriggerRule;
-DROP TABLE IF EXISTS ContextTriggerTemplate;
-DROP TABLE IF EXISTS ContextTriggerCustomTemplate;
-
-DROP TABLE IF EXISTS Battery_LastInfo;
-DROP TABLE IF EXISTS Log_AppLaunch;
-DROP TABLE IF EXISTS Log_RemovableApp;
-DROP TABLE IF EXISTS Temp_AppLaunchFreq ;
-DROP TABLE IF EXISTS Temp_LastCpuUsagePerApp;
-DROP TABLE IF EXISTS Log_BatteryUsagePerApp;
-EOF
-
-fi